The course deals with the basic terms and processes involved in applying computer networks. The course frame will include an introduction of communication protocols at different communication layers, physical devices, communication architectures, information security, cloud computing, and state of the art subjects such as IoT (Internet of Things). The student will acquire basic knowledge in computer networking with a perspective of how to functionally implement those technologies. Teaching methodology is based on the 5 layers model (Internet Protocol Suite) in a Top to Bottom order.

 

The exercises will include an implementation of networks models using Python based simulation.
